PSG and Morocco star Achraf Hakimi is set to stand trial for rape, it has been confirmed.
It comes after the 27-year-old had his appeal to the French criminal court rejected.
In February 2023, a woman who was aged 24 at the time told police in the Val-De-Marne region southeast of Paris that Hakimi had sexually assaulted her at his home.
The Moroccan appeared in person at the Versailles Court of Appeal on 22 May to request the case be dismissed.
However, the court has confirmed that the trial is still going ahead.
It said in a statement: "The investigations carried out during the preliminary inquiry and the judicial investigation led the investigating chamber to conclude that there is sufficient evidence against Mr. Achraf Hakimi Mouh to justify his indictment before the departmental criminal court of Hauts-de-Seine."
Meanwhile, Hakimi also released his own statement this morning on social media.
He wrote: "The justice system looked me in the eyes and told me: 'If you weren't famous, there would never have been a case."
"I chose to stay quiet for years. I thought that in staying dignified, in being patient and having confidence in the justice system that the right decisions would be taken.
"Today, a story which is not mine has been told to the detriment of my familly, of my life and most of all of the truth.
"I have often had the feeling of having become an easy target.
"I have been awaiting this trial since the first day. And I await it from now on with impatience.
"Finally, I will be able to speak."
Hakimi is currently playing at the World Cup in North America for Morocco.
He is set to play tonight against Scotland.
